Marriage to a Polish citizen is not enough to claim Polish citizenship and a passport. A foreigner must apply for a temporary residence permit based on the marriage and then apply for permanent residence based on the marriage. Once permanent Polish residence is obtained, a foreigner must stay married to the Polish citizen for 3 years and have stayed in Poland legally and uninterrupted for 2 years before applying for Polish citizenship based on marriage. Your Polish language skills must be certified.

Do you get citizenship if you marry a Polish woman?
A foreign national must live in Poland for at least two years on a permanent residence permit or a long-term EU residence permit to apply for Polish citizenship through marriage. Your stay in Poland must be uninterrupted for two years. Polish law says you can’t be away from Poland for more than six months. You can’t be outside the country for six months in a row. Also, all breaks should not last more than 10 months in total over two years.
